According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 19 reports of Hyponatraemia have been filed in association with AMILORIDE\FUROSEMIDE. This represents 25.0% of all adverse event reports for AMILORIDE\FUROSEMIDE.

How Dangerous Is Hyponatraemia From AMILORIDE\FUROSEMIDE?
Of the 19 reports, 19 (100.0%) required hospitalization.
Is Hyponatraemia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for AMILORIDE\FUROSEMIDE. However, 19 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
